About Obsidian Publish MCP Server

Connect your Obsidian Publish environment to your AI agent and construct an intelligent oracle that reads smoothly from your personal or corporate markdown knowledge base.

Claude Code registers Obsidian Publish as an MCP server in a single terminal command. Once connected, Claude Code discovers all 5 tools at runtime and can call them headlessly. ideal for CI/CD pipelines, cron jobs, and automated workflows where Obsidian Publish data drives decisions without human intervention.

What you can do

  • Vault Crawling — Programmatically fetch your entire published vault structure utilizing list_files and list_navigation to build contextual trees.
  • Direct Note Access — Execute get_file to stream the complete raw markdown contents of any note directly into your chat workflow for fast summarization.
  • Metadata Operations — Use get_metadata to retrieve frontmatter properties, tags, and internal link logic mapped by Obsidian.
  • Site Auditing — Easily ping site_info to ensure connectivity and verify the deployment status of your target Obsidian publish endpoint.

How to Connect Obsidian Publish to Claude Code via MCP

Follow these steps to integrate the Obsidian Publish MCP Server with Claude Code.

01

Install Claude Code

Run npm install -g @anthropic-ai/claude-code if not already installed

02

Add the MCP Server

Run the command above in your terminal

03

Verify the connection

Run claude mcp to list connected servers, or type /mcp inside a session

04

Start using Obsidian Publish

Ask Claude: "Using Obsidian Publish, show me...". 5 tools are ready

Obsidian Publish MCP Tools for Claude Code (5)

These 5 tools become available when you connect Obsidian Publish to Claude Code via MCP:

01

get_file

Retrieve exact textual file content and binary assets

02

get_metadata

Extract internal creation hashes mapping a specific Markdown page

03

list_files

List all explicitly published raw file paths across the Obsidian workspace

04

list_navigation

Visualize structurally formatted Markdown navigation trees

05

site_info

Identify global configuration and styling mapping the site

Obsidian Publish + Claude Code FAQ

Common questions about integrating Obsidian Publish MCP Server with Claude Code.

01

How do I add an MCP server to Claude Code?

Run claude mcp add --transport http "" in your terminal. Claude Code registers the server and discovers all tools immediately.
02

Can Claude Code run MCP tools in headless mode?

Yes. Claude Code supports non-interactive execution, making it ideal for scripts, cron jobs, and CI/CD pipelines that need MCP tool access.
03

How do I list all connected MCP servers?

Run claude mcp in your terminal to see all registered servers and their status, or type /mcp inside an active Claude Code session.
